Tia and Paloma are in foster together and must be adopted together. Both girls are very loving and playful. They like to cuddle up on their foster carer's lap, then have a quick play fight, before going back for more human cuddles. They can be worried by loud noises so cannot be homed with young children or in busy households.

Betty is a calm and affectionate girl. In her foster home she has been keen to make friends with the resident dog, and would love to have a canine companion in her forever home. PAWS is looking for an active, adult-only home or a home with teenage children for Betty who is anxious around young children.
